Dubbo 3.0,它是 HSF & 开源 Dubbo 后的融合产品,在兼容两款框 架的基础上做了全面的云原生架构升级,它将成为未来面向阿里内部与开源社区的主推产品。Dubbo 3.0 诞生的大背景是阿里巴巴在推动的全站业务上云,这为我们中间件产品全 面拥抱云上业务,提供内部、开源一致的产品提出了要求也提供了契机,让中间件产品有望 彻底摆脱自研体系、开源体系多线作战的局面,有利于实现价值最大化的局面。一方面阿里 电商系统大规模实践的经验可以输出到社区,另一方面社区优秀的开发者也能参与到项目贡 献中。以服务框架为例,HSF 和 Dubbo 都是非常成功的产品:HSF 在内部支撑历届双 十一,性能优异且久经考验;而在开源侧,Dubbo 坐稳国内第一开源服务框架宝座,用户 群体非常广泛。 同时维护两款高度同质化的产品,对研发效率、业务成本、产品质量与稳定性都是非常 大的考验。举例来说,首先,Dubbo 与 HSF 体系的互通是一个非常大的障碍,在阿里内 部的一些生态公司如考拉、饿了么等都在使用 Dubbo 技术栈的情况下,要实现顺利平滑 的与 HSF 的互调互通一直以来都是一个非常大的障碍;其次,产品不兼容导致社区输出 成本过高、质量验收等成本也随之增长,内部业务积累的服务化经验与成果无法直接赋能社 区,二次改造适配 Dubbo 后功能性、稳定性验收都要重新投入验证。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
阿里云拥有国内全面的云原生产品技术以及大规模的云原生应用实践,通过全面容器化、核心技术互联网化、应用 Serverless 化三大范式,助力制造业企业高效上云,实现系统稳定、应用敏捷智能。拥抱云原生,让创新无处不在。